titleOfInvention | Manufacturing method of photothermographic material |
abstract | PROBLEM TO BE SOLVED: To provide a photothermographic material having a high gradation, a good halftone dot quality, a small rise in fog at the time of high-temperature storage, and hardly causing black spots. SOLUTION: On one surface of a support, a non-photosensitive organic silver salt, a photosensitive silver halide, a reducing agent for silver ions, a binder, and a development start point on and near the non-photosensitive organic silver salt.
